DS26LS31C, DS26LS31M www.ti.com SNOSBK1C - JUNE 1998 - REVISED APRIL 2013 DS26LS31C/DS26LS31M Quad High Speed Differential Line Driver Check for Samples: DS26LS31C, DS26LS31M FEATURES DESCRIPTION * * * * * The DS26LS31 is a quad differential line driver designed for digital data transmission over balanced lines. The DS26LS31 meets all the requirements of EIA Standard RS-422 and Federal Standard 1020. It is designed to provide unipolar differential drive to twisted-pair or parallel-wire transmission lines. 1 2 * * * * * Output Skew--2.0 ns Typical Input to output delay--10 ns Typical Operation from Single 5V Supply Outputs Won't Load Line when VCC = 0V Four Line Drivers in One Package for Maximum Package Density Output Short-Circuit Protection Complementary Outputs Meets the Requirements of EIA Standard RS422 Pin Compatible with AM26LS31 Available in Military and Commercial Temperature Range The circuit provides an enable and disable common to all four drivers. The DS26LS31 TRI-STATE outputs and logically complementary outputs. Copyright (c) 1998-2013, Texas Instruments Incorporated DS26LS31C, DS26LS31M SNOSBK1C - JUNE 1998 - REVISED APRIL 2013 www.ti.com These devices have limited built-in ESD protection. The leads should be shorted together or the device placed in conductive foam during storage or handling to prevent electrostatic damage to the MOS gates. (2) RoHS: TI defines "RoHS" to mean semiconductor products that are compliant with the current EU RoHS requirements for all 10 RoHS substances, including the requirement that RoHS substance do not exceed 0.1% by weight in homogeneous materials. Where designed to be soldered at high temperatures, "RoHS" products are suitable for use in specified lead-free processes. TI may reference these types of products as "Pb-Free". RoHS Exempt: TI defines "RoHS Exempt" to mean products that contain lead but are compliant with EU RoHS pursuant to a specific EU RoHS exemption. Green: TI defines "Green" to mean the content of Chlorine (Cl) and Bromine (Br) based flame retardants meet JS709B low halogen requirements of <=1000ppm threshold. Antimony trioxide based flame retardants must also meet the <=1000ppm threshold requirement.
